Blooms and Bubbly

Take some time for yourself during spring break.

Spring break is upon us! Last week, Great Escape focused on those of you heading to the beach, the mountains or other fun sites. This week’s feature is for parents staying in Woodstock for the break.

Having a week of family time is great, and there are many local, family-friendly things to do. But let’s face it–parents, especially moms, can burn out quickly during a week of fixing extra meals, coordinating activities, hosting other kids in the house and managing overtired children.

If you stay at home during spring break, I suggest a midweek date with your spouse. Find a sitter and spend some quiet adult time, which will re-energize you for the final stretch of the school vacation.

The Atlanta Botanical Garden hosts Blooms and Bubbly on Thursday, April 7, from 5 to 8 o’clock. Sip champagne, beer or wine from the cash bar while you relax amid colorful blooming tulips and other seasonal bulbs. You will enjoy the numerous annual flowers that accent the garden, each whimsically sculptured into larger-than-life forms.

Non-ABG members pay $18.95 per person, which is the price of admission to the garden. Enjoy your relaxing outdoor evening of Blooms and Bubbly!
